This will be my 1500th post here on AG. The car that I am using for this milestone is a 300 SL Gullwing on vintage New York tags. ( W16 23 ) 1955. I spotted this legend in the valet in front of the F&B Restaurant located off of Peachtree. As we approached the car the Gullwing doors were already up and the very lucky owner was getting ready to claim the car. We only had time for a handful of shots. When the car started up it really sounded fierce and powerful very much like a race car. In fact we could hear the car well out of view accelerating down the street. I have spotted a 300 SL before in Miami and that car did not sound like this one. In fact when I looked over these shots at home I noticed that she had no rear exhaust. The pipes were situated on the passenger side of the vehicle. I did do some research on the internet and found a few pics of a similar car with those same side exhaust tips. That car had decals that read La Carrera Panamericana from the Mexico Race. This car even had the extra lamps on the front nose.
